System with brake to limit manual movement of member and control system for same

US10052166B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10052166-B2
Application numberUS-201715670894-A
CountryUS
Kind codeB2
Filing dateAug 7, 2017
Priority dateOct 1, 2009
Publication dateAug 21, 2018
Grant dateAug 21, 2018

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A robotic system includes an articulated member comprising a joint and configured to be manually moved by a user to facilitate performance of a task and a controller. The controller is programmed to determine whether an angular position of the joint is moved within an angular range of motion defined by a braking region, generate a force feedback signal compensating for a gravitational load on the articulated member to inhibit manual movement in space of at least a portion of the articulated member when the angular position of the joint is in the braking region, and maintain the force feedback signal until a user disengages the force feedback.

First claim

Opening claim text (preview).

What is claimed is: 1. A robotic system, comprising: an articulated member comprising a joint and configured to be manually moved by a user to facilitate performance of a task; and a controller programmed to: determine whether an angular position of the joint is moved within an angular range of motion defined by a braking region; generate a force feedback signal compensating for a gravitational load on the articulated member to inhibit manual movement in space of at least a portion of the articulated member when the angular position of the joint is in the braking region; and maintain the force feedback signal until a user disengages force feedback. 2. The robotic system of claim 1 , wherein the articulated member is configured to couple to at least a first object and a second object that is interchangeable with the first object and has a different weight than the first object. 3. The robotic system of claim 1 , wherein the controller is programmed to enable the user to continuously modify at least one of a size of the braking region, a location of the braking region, a shape of the braking region, and a magnitude of the force feedback signal. 4. The robotic system of claim 1 , wherein the controller is programmed to enable the user to modify at least one of the braking region and a magnitude of the force feedback signal without changing a mechanical configuration of the robotic system. 5. The robotic system of claim 1 , wherein the controller is programmed to maintain the force feedback signal until the user moves the articulated member such that the angular position of the joint is outside of the braking region. 6. The robotic system of claim 1 , wherein the controller is programmed to maintain the force feedback signal until the user turns off the force feedback. 7. The robotic system of claim 1 , wherein the articulated member includes at least one unbraked joint, and wherein the controller is programmed to maintain the force feedback signal until the user manually moves at least a portion of the articulated member comprising an unbraked joint. 8. A method of inhibiting movement of an articulated member, comprising: determining whether an angular position of a joint of the articulated member is moved within an angular range of motion defined by a braking region; generating a force feedback signal compensating for a gravitational load on the articulated member to inhibit manual movement in space of at least a portion of the articulated member when the angular position of the joint is in the braking region; and maintaining the force feedback signal until a user disengages force feedback. 9. The method of claim 8 , wherein the articulated member is configured to couple to at least a first object and a second object that is interchangeable with the first object and has a different weight than the first object. 10. The method of claim 8 , further comprising enabling the user to continuously modify at least one of a size of the braking region, a location of the braking region, a shape of the braking region, and a magnitude of the force feedback signal. 11. The method of claim 8 , further comprising enabling the user to modify at least one of the braking region and a magnitude of the force feedback signal without changing a mechanical configuration of a robotic system comprising the articulated member. 12. The method of claim 8 , wherein maintaining the force feedback signal comprises maintaining the force feedback signal until the user moves the articulated member such that the angular position of the joint is outside of the braking region. 13. The method of claim 8 , wherein maintaining the force feedback signal comprises maintaining the force feedback signal until the user turns off the force feedback. 14. The method of claim 8 , wherein the articulated member includes at least one unbraked joint, and wherein maintaining the force feedback signal comprises maintaining the force feedback signal until the user manually moves at least a portion of the articulated member comprising an unbraked joint. 15. The method of claim 8 , wherein generating the force feedback signal comprises generating the force feedback signal continuously in the braking region. 16. The method of claim 8 , wherein generating the force feedback signal comprises generating the force feedback signal discontinuously in the braking region. 17. A control system configured to be integrated with a robotic system having a moveable member comprising a joint, comprising: a controller programmed to: determine whether an angular position of the joint is moved within an angular range of motion defined by a braking region; generate a force feedback signal compensating for a gravitational load on the moveable member to inhibit manual movement in space of at least a portion of the moveable member when the angular position of the joint is in the braking region; and maintain the force feedback signal until a user disengages force feedback. 18. The control system of claim 17 , wherein the controller is configured to generate the force feedback signal for payloads of the robotic system having different weights. 19. The control system of claim 17 , wherein the controller is programmed to maintain the force feedback signal until the user moves the moveable member such that the angular position of the joint is outside of the braking region. 20. The control system of claim 17 , wherein the controller is programmed to maintain the force feedback signal until the user turns off the force feedback. 21. The control system of claim 17 , wherein the movable member includes at least one unbraked joint, and wherein the controller is programmed to maintain the force feedback signal until the user manually moves at least a portion of the movable member comprising an unbraked joint.

Assignees

Inventors

Classifications

  • A61B34/20Primary

    Surgical navigation systems; Devices for tracking or guiding surgical instruments, e.g. for frameless stereotaxis · CPC title

  • Coupling (A61B2017/0046 takes precedence) · CPC title

  • for the acetabulum · CPC title

  • Chucks or tool parts which are to be held in a chuck · CPC title

  • of acetabular cups ·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10052166B2 cover?
A robotic system includes an articulated member comprising a joint and configured to be manually moved by a user to facilitate performance of a task and a controller. The controller is programmed to determine whether an angular position of the joint is moved within an angular range of motion defined by a braking region, generate a force feedback signal compensating for a gravitational load on t…
Who is the assignee on this patent?
Mako Surgical Corp
What technology area does this patent fall under?
Primary CPC classification A61B34/20. Mapped technology areas include Human Necessities.
When was this patent published?
Publication date Tue Aug 21 2018 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 2 related publications on this page (citations in our corpus or others sharing the same primary CPC).